Maruti’s Future Concept S based Micro-SUV: What we know so far?

Maruti Suzuki is soon going to introduce an all-new micro-SUV and position it below the Vitara Brezza to compete against the Mahindra KUV100.

The segment of compact SUVs has in the recent past seen a massive increase in demand in India. Our country’s love for vehicles with butch appearance is increasing day by day resulting in manufacturers applying the formula to each and every segment. In addition to spawning sub-4-meter SUVs. this craze has now led to the development of micro-SUVs, vehicles which are essentially hatchbacks but sport an SUV-ish design as well as ride height.

new maruti zen image

Currently, the only player in this segment is the Mahindra KUV100. Despite its rather radical design, the same has found space in a considerable amount of homes in India. Observing this, other automobile manufacturers have now gone to the drawing board and started working on their respective iterations of Micro-SUVs. And one of those who has publicly announced the arrival of their version, by the end of this year, is Maruti Suzuki.

The Concept Future S which was showcased at the 2018 Auto Expo is soon going to spawn an all-new Micro-SUV for the Indo-Japanese automaker. It will be positioned right below the Vitara Brezza and is going to use the same platform as that of the Ignis. Various reports claim that the same might be named as the ‘Zen’, hence bringing back the famous moniker for Maruti in India.

It is quite early to comment on the engine line-up of Maruti’s new Micro-SUV. However, we speculate that it is going to get only a petrol engine in its portfolio and miss out on a diesel. We say that because this vehicle is going to fall in-between the price range of INR 5 lakh to INR 7 lakh. And this being a budget segment, the cost of a BS-VI complaint diesel engine will well exceed the acceptable mark.

That said, the said Micro-SUV from Maruti Suzuki is going to be quite feature rich, especially in its top-spec trim. The list will include LED daytime running lights, projector headlamps, LED tail-lamps, a touchscreen infotainment system, steering mounted audio controls among others.
